Dans le contexte dynamique du marché numérique d’aujourd’hui, offrir une expérience utilisateur fluide et cohérérente n’est plus une option, mais une nécessité. La distinction entre applications web et applications natives tend à s’estomper lorsque les progrès technologiques permettent d’intégrer des fonctionnalités avancées directement dans des plateformes web, donnant naissance à ce qu’on appelle souvent des solutions hybrides ou “app native-like”.
La montée en puissance des Progressive Web Apps (PWA) et des applications hybrides
Depuis quelques années, les technologies telles que les Progressive Web Apps (PWA) ont révolutionné la conception d’applications web. En combinant la portabilité d’un site web avec la performance et la sensation d’une application native, elles offrent une expérience utilisateur exceptionnelle, tout en évitant les complexités de développement pour plusieurs plateformes distinctes.
“Les utilisateurs attendent aujourd’hui une synchronisation parfaite entre leur expérience mobile et desktop. Les solutions hybrides répondent à cette exigence, offrant rapidité, fiabilité, et engagement.” — Expert en expérience utilisateur, TechInsights Magazine
Les défis de l’intégration native pour les développeurs
Malgré leurs avantages, les développeurs font face à plusieurs défis lorsqu’il s’agit de rendre leur application web aussi fluide qu’une app native :
- Performance et réactivité : La latence peut nuire à l’utilisateur, surtout pour des applications riches en interactions.
- Accès aux fonctionnalités hardware : Émettre des notifications, accéder à la caméra, ou exploiter le GPS — ces fonctionnalités sont critiques pour une expérience native.
- Compatibilité et mise à jour : Assurer une compatibilité sur divers devices et garder l’application à jour du point de vue technologique.
Comment transformer une web app en une expérience native
Une solution consiste à utiliser des frameworks et outils qui permettent d’«utiliser Juicy Stems comme une app native». Ce processus ne consiste pas simplement à encapsuler une application web dans une architecture native, mais à créer une expérience utilisateur fluide, rapide et intégrée, tout en profitant de la souplesse du développement web.
Étude de cas : Juicy Stems et l’intégration native
Juicy Stems, plateforme spécialisée dans la gestion et la visualisation de données musicales, a récemment adopté cette approche. En utilisant des techniques modernes d’intégration, la société a permis à ses utilisateurs d’accéder à une expérience semblable à celle d’une application native, directement via leur navigateur, tout en bénéficiant de fonctionnalités très proches de celles d’une app installée.
Pour faciliter cette transition, Juicy Stems a opté pour des frameworks comme React Native et WebAssembly, permettant une interaction rapide avec le hardware et une performance optimisée. Leur approche a inclus l’installation d’un niveau de service PWA avancé, ce qui permet de :
- Offrir des chargements quasi-instantanés
- Travailler hors ligne
- Envoyer des notifications push pertinentes
- Intégrer des accès aux capteurs et autres fonctionnalités natives
Ce cas illustre l’importance d’utiliser des technologies évolutives pour converger vers une expérience utilisateur haut de gamme, à la fois cohérente et performante.
Conclusion : La voie vers une expérience utilisateur sans compromis
En définitive, la capacité à utiliser Juicy Stems comme une app native n’est pas simplement un atout technologique. C’est une stratégie essentielle pour différencier des concurrents et répondre aux attentes croissantes des utilisateurs modernes. La conception d’applications web qui emploient ces techniques de transition vers le natif ouvre la voie à une nouvelle ère d’interactions, où la performance et la simplicité d’utilisation sont gages de succès durables.
Les prospectives futures suggèrent une intégration plus poussée de ces stratégies, avec l’émergence d’outils encore plus sophistiqués. L’enjeu pour les entreprises est clair : adopter ces technologies pour offrir une expérience utilisateur inégalée, tout en optimisant le coût et la maintenance des applications.
Points clés à retenir
| Aspect | Description |
|---|---|
| Performance | Utiliser des techniques modernes pour une réactivité comparable à une app native. |
| Accès aux fonctionnalités natives | Intégration d’API pour notifications, GPS, caméra, etc. |
| Expérience utilisateur | Fluidité, rapidité et cohérence multiplateforme. |
| Technologies clés | PWAs, React Native, WebAssembly, frameworks de migration |
En résumé, la capacité à utiliser Juicy Stems comme une app native s’inscrit parfaitement dans cette tendance d’innovation. Elle illustre la volonté des entreprises de proposer des expériences immersives, performantes, et adaptées aux exigences modernes, tout en évitant la complexité d’un développement totalement natif.